1195    Merging from release1_p8:
1196    o verification/natl_box:
1197      updating new external_fields_load routine
1198    o New package: pkg/seaice
1199      Sea ice model by D. Menemenlis (JPL) and Jinlun Zhang (Seattle).
1200      The sea-ice code is based on Hibler (1979-1980).
1201      Two sea-ice dynamic solvers, ADI and LSR, are included.
1202      In addition to computing prognostic sea-ice variables and diagnosing
1203      the forcing/external data fields that drive the ocean model,
1204      SEAICE_MODEL also sets theta to the freezing point under sea-ice.
1205      The implied surface heat flux is then stored in variable
1206      surfaceTendencyTice, which is needed by KPP package (kpp_calc.F and
1207      kpp_transport_t.F) to diagnose surface buoyancy fluxes and for the
1208      non-local transport term.  Because this call precedes model
1209      thermodynamics, temperature under sea-ice may not be "exactly" at
1210      the freezing point by the time theta is dumped or time-averaged.

1300      declare all the variables _RL ; use _d 0 for all numerical constants.
1301      use ifdef ALLOW_AIM everywhere. And now AIM can be used with g77 !
1302    
1303    checkpoint46h_post
1304    o cleaned up the use of rhoNil and rhoConst.
1305      - rhoNil should only appear in the LINEAR equation of state, everywhere
1306        else rhoNil is replaced by rhoConst, e.g. find_rho computes rho-rhoConst
1307        and the dynamical equations are all divided by rhoConst
1308    o introduced new parameter rhoConstFresh, a reference density of fresh
1309      water, to remove the fresh water flux's dependence on rhoNil. The default
1310      value is 999.8 kg/m^3
1311    o cleanup up external_forcing.F and external_forcing_surf.F
1312      - can now be used by both OCEANIC and OCEANICP
1313    checkpoint46h_pre
1314

1316     a mass flux when using P coordinates in the ocean (OCEANICP).
1317     Note: It assumes you have set rho0=rhoConst=density of fresh water.
1318    
1319    checkpoint46g_post
1320    o Include a new diagnostic variable phiHydLow for the ocean model
1321      - in z-coordinates, it is the bottom pressure anomaly
1322      - in p-coordinates, it is the sea surface elevation
1323      - in both cases, these variable have global drift, reflecting the mass
1324        drift in z-coordinates and the volume drift in p-coordinates
1325      - included time averaging for phiHydLow, be aware of the drift!
1326    o depth-dependent computation of Bo_surf for pressure coordinates
1327      in the ocean (buoyancyRelation='OCEANICP')
1328      - requires a new routine (FIND_RHO_SCALAR) to compute density with only
1329        Theta, Salinity, and Pressure in the parameter list. This routine is
1330        presently contained in find_rho.F. This routine does not give the
1331        correct density for 'POLY3', which would be a z-dependent reference
1332        density.
1333    o cleaned up find_rho
